Home
last modified time | relevance | path

Searched refs:FullComment (Results 1 – 14 of 14) sorted by relevance

/freebsd/contrib/llvm-project/clang/include/clang/AST/
H A DTextNodeDumper.h131 const comments::FullComment *>,
171 void Visit(const comments::Comment *C, const comments::FullComment *FC);
223 const comments::FullComment *);
225 const comments::FullComment *);
227 const comments::FullComment *);
229 const comments::FullComment *);
231 const comments::FullComment *);
233 const comments::FullComment *FC);
235 const comments::FullComment *FC);
237 const comments::FullComment *);
[all …]
H A DJSONNodeDumper.h119 const comments::FullComment *>,
138 const comments::FullComment *>;
202 void Visit(const comments::Comment *C, const comments::FullComment *FC);
353 const comments::FullComment *);
355 const comments::FullComment *);
357 const comments::FullComment *);
359 const comments::FullComment *);
361 const comments::FullComment *);
363 const comments::FullComment *FC);
365 const comments::FullComment *FC);
[all …]
H A DRawCommentList.h29 class FullComment; variable
169 comments::FullComment *parse(const ASTContext &Context,
H A DCommentParser.h122 FullComment *parseFullComment();
H A DASTNodeTraverser.h69 const comments::FullComment *>,
118 if (const comments::FullComment *Comment =
298 void Visit(const comments::Comment *C, const comments::FullComment *FC) { in Visit()
305 const comments::FullComment *>::visit(C, in Visit()
H A DASTContext.h128 class FullComment; variable
855 mutable llvm::DenseMap<const Decl *, comments::FullComment *> ParsedComments;
905 comments::FullComment *getCommentForDecl(const Decl *D,
911 comments::FullComment *getLocalCommentForDeclUncached(const Decl *D) const;
913 comments::FullComment *cloneFullComment(comments::FullComment *FC,
/freebsd/contrib/llvm-project/clang/include/clang/Index/
H A DCommentToXML.h18 class FullComment; variable
28 void convertCommentToHTML(const comments::FullComment *FC,
36 void convertCommentToXML(const comments::FullComment *FC,
/freebsd/contrib/llvm-project/clang/lib/Index/
H A DCommentToXML.cpp85 FullCommentParts(const FullComment *C,
98 FullCommentParts::FullCommentParts(const FullComment *C, in FullCommentParts()
185 case CommentKind::FullComment: in FullCommentParts()
222 CommentASTToHTMLConverter(const FullComment *FC, in CommentASTToHTMLConverter()
243 void visitFullComment(const FullComment *C);
254 const FullComment *FC;
443 void CommentASTToHTMLConverter::visitFullComment(const FullComment *C) { in visitFullComment()
533 CommentASTToXMLConverter(const FullComment *FC, in CommentASTToXMLConverter()
559 void visitFullComment(const FullComment *C);
569 const FullComment *FC;
[all …]
/freebsd/contrib/llvm-project/clang/lib/AST/
H A DASTDumper.cpp310 const auto *FC = dyn_cast<FullComment>(this); in dump()
319 const auto *FC = dyn_cast<FullComment>(this); in dump()
327 const auto *FC = dyn_cast<FullComment>(this); in dumpColor()
H A DJSONNodeDumper.cpp150 const comments::FullComment *FC) { in Visit()
1723 const comments::FullComment *) { in visitTextComment() argument
1728 const comments::InlineCommandComment *C, const comments::FullComment *) { in visitInlineCommandComment() argument
1758 const comments::HTMLStartTagComment *C, const comments::FullComment *) { in visitHTMLStartTagComment() argument
1773 const comments::HTMLEndTagComment *C, const comments::FullComment *) { in visitHTMLEndTagComment() argument
1778 const comments::BlockCommandComment *C, const comments::FullComment *) { in visitBlockCommandComment() argument
1790 const comments::ParamCommandComment *C, const comments::FullComment *FC) { in visitParamCommandComment()
1813 const comments::TParamCommandComment *C, const comments::FullComment *FC) { in visitTParamCommandComment()
1828 const comments::VerbatimBlockComment *C, const comments::FullComment *) { in visitVerbatimBlockComment() argument
1835 const comments::FullComment *) { in visitVerbatimBlockLineComment() argument
[all …]
H A DTextNodeDumper.cpp73 const comments::FullComment *FC) { in Visit()
88 const comments::FullComment *>::visit(C, FC); in Visit()
994 const comments::FullComment *) { in visitTextComment() argument
999 const comments::InlineCommandComment *C, const comments::FullComment *) { in visitInlineCommandComment() argument
1024 const comments::HTMLStartTagComment *C, const comments::FullComment *) { in visitHTMLStartTagComment() argument
1038 const comments::HTMLEndTagComment *C, const comments::FullComment *) { in visitHTMLEndTagComment() argument
1043 const comments::BlockCommandComment *C, const comments::FullComment *) { in visitBlockCommandComment() argument
1050 const comments::ParamCommandComment *C, const comments::FullComment *FC) { in visitParamCommandComment()
1071 const comments::TParamCommandComment *C, const comments::FullComment *FC) { in visitTParamCommandComment()
1091 const comments::VerbatimBlockComment *C, const comments::FullComment *) { in visitVerbatimBlockComment() argument
[all …]
H A DASTContext.cpp552 comments::FullComment *FC = DocComment->parse(*this, PP, D); in attachCommentsToJustParsedDecls()
560 comments::FullComment *ASTContext::cloneFullComment(comments::FullComment *FC, in cloneFullComment()
569 comments::FullComment *CFC = in cloneFullComment()
570 new (*this) comments::FullComment(FC->getBlocks(), in cloneFullComment()
575 comments::FullComment *ASTContext::getLocalCommentForDeclUncached(const Decl *D) const { in getLocalCommentForDeclUncached()
580 comments::FullComment *ASTContext::getCommentForDecl( in getCommentForDecl()
588 llvm::DenseMap<const Decl *, comments::FullComment *>::iterator Pos = in getCommentForDecl()
593 comments::FullComment *FC = Pos->second; in getCommentForDecl()
594 comments::FullComment *CFC = cloneFullComment(FC, D); in getCommentForDecl()
609 if (comments::FullComment *FC = getCommentForDecl(PDecl, PP)) in getCommentForDecl()
[all …]
H A DCommentParser.cpp918 FullComment *Parser::parseFullComment() { in parseFullComment()
/freebsd/contrib/llvm-project/clang/include/clang/Basic/
H A DCommentNodes.td26 def FullComment : CommentNode<Comment>;